WebApr 2, 2024 · PAH is a condition that increases pressure in your pulmonary artery. The pulmonary artery is the large blood vessel that brings blood from your heart to your lungs. What causes PAH? PAH may be passed from a parent to a child. This is called familial PAH. PAH with no known cause is called idiopathic PAH. WebTravelling with PH Home Living with Pulmonary Hypertension Travelling with PH Having pulmonary hypertension should not stop you travelling or enjoying holidays within the UK or abroad. There may be extra things to consider, so travelling just requires more planning – but it can definitely be done!

WebPeople with mild PAH, who only use oxygen when they're sleeping or doing certain things, may not need in-flight oxygen. Others with a more severe case may need it.
